If, having joined the tables, you align their left & right borders, you could use the column width dialogue in the table Tools context menu to manually set the widths.
Alternatively, having aligned the left & right borders, you could use the 'distribute columns' tool in the table Tools context menu to make all the columns an even width. If the results widths aren't what you want, you can then click on any of the column borders to drag the columns borders left/right - or you can use the column width dialogue in the table Tools context menu to manually set the widths.
